allow the delta base file to lose its header between deltify_init and deltify
This simplifies pack file creation. A delta base could be read from a
loose object, a packfile, or it might be available in a temporary file.
All these cases can now be handled the same way. We may need to open,
close, and re-open a given delta base multiple times while packing.

raw object size should not include the length of the object's header
This way, the size of a raw object is the same regardless of whether
the object was found in a loose object file or in a pack file.

use socketpair(2) instead of pipe(2) for bi-directional communication
On Linux, pipes returned from pipe(2) only work in one direction.
This broke 'got clone' over ssh in the -portable version because
got-fetch-pack assumes it can use its fetchfd for both reading and writing.
I wrote a complicated diff to use two pipe(2) calls instead of one, but
millert suggested a simpler solution: Use socketpair(2) instead of pipe(2).

use Patience diff for merging during cherrypick/backout/histedit/rebase
This has been shown to prevent mis-merges in some cases. It's probably
not a final solution. We should look at what Git's "recursive merge"
is doing and implement something similar.
Keep using Myers during update/unstage. The advantage of Myers is that
it produces smaller conflict chunks, and there are no known cases of
mis-merges which affect update/unstage.
